Imagine the bag is the PM, says activist Eru Kapa-Kingi – then he unleashes a flurry of punches
Activist Eru Kapa-Kingi has shared a video of himself punching a bag, which he told followers they could imagine was Prime Minister Christopher Luxon.
The video was shared by Kapa-Kingi on his Instagram page on Thursday morning, with the activist asking people in the comments to “let us know what/who you’re imagining the bag to be”.
In the video, Kapa-Kingi said people could “pick up the intensity” of their training by first imagining the bag was a concept they hated.
“If you want to pick up the intensity of your training, you [could] imagine that this bag is either, like a concept that you hate, like racism, or colonisation, or stealing of indigenous land,” he said.
Kapa-Kingi then said people could “make it more personal”, by imagining the bag was a person they did not like, specifically mentioning Luxon.
“Make it a person like, the current Prime Minister of New Zealand,” he said, before repeatedly punching the bag.
